As one of the outstanding cellists of his generation, Mark Kosower is hailed by musicians and critics alike for his instrumental mastery and deep musical integrity. A product of Janos Starker at Indiana University and Joel Krosnick at the Juilliard School, Mr. Kosower’s notable honors include Grand Prize of the Seventh Irving Klein International String Competition, first-prize at the Aspen Music Festival and the Juilliard Cello Concerto competitions, and top prizes in the Rostropovich and Pablo Casals International Cello competitions. Mark is joined by pianist Jee-Won Oh for a luscious evening of music by J.S. Bach, Poulenc, Ginastera, Kodaly, Mendelssohn, and Popper. Indulge yourself!
